ZX12's spank Busa's at SoCal Dyno Show
Just a few notes from Saturday results. Of all bikes to show up, the 12 that everyone whined about them not buying for $8k (carbon wheels, bodywork, etc Muzzy motor) was there! In person, this bike is bitchin! Super nice guy, Kerry Ward, spanked his buddies modified Busa(s) handily. I'll have final results tomorrow and more details. Actually, I'm in 2nd place, but my motor is stock!
Overall leader is John A. - Turbo Harley FLH - 225 hp
Open Sportbike;
Kerry W. ZX12 - 186.9 hp
Kerry B. ZX12 - 175.8 hp
Funny thing. Most of the Busa crowd was questioning the dyno readout numbers. For referance, mine put out within a few 10ths of what it did at our company last week. John's Turbo H-D put out within 2 hp of what he did last week. So much for the doubters.... The dyno don't lie. Kerry W.'s bike surprised me though. Even though it has ton's of miles on the engine, I expected a much higher reading? Maybe it's "detuned" for longevity? Kerry W. did not know much about the tech side of the motor, so who knows. He just knew it was a steaming deal and layed out the cash. Smart guy!
John Noonan from JE Pistons will be there tomorrow. He should spank the Turbo Harley. Noonan expects to see minimum of 350 hp plus. Will try to post all winners tomorrow and more details.
